Other Dynamic Equilibrium vs. Passive Static Stability: Why Nature Rejects Fixed Wings and the Implications for Multi-Modal Design By Denny Reid, age 85, New Zealand
For over a century, aeronautical orthodoxy has remained tied to positive static stability. We design airframes that inherently resist displacement through substantial horizontal stabilizers, fixed geometric decalage, and passive aerodynamic damping. The operational penalty is structural parasitic mass, continuous trim drag, and an operational envelope strictly confined to prepared runways and smooth fluid regimes.
Nature solves this differently. Biological fliers do not rely on static aerodynamic stability; they operate continuously in an active state of dynamic/unstable equilibrium. By continuously modulating control surfaces via closed-loop sensory feedback (sensing real-time acceleration vectors rather than relying on geometric righting moments), birds bats and pterosaurs achieve zero trim penalty, extreme gust tolerance, and broad operational flexibility.
When we replace passive static stability assumptions with high-rate, closed-loop accelerometer sensing, the traditional boundaries between operational domains begin to shift:
Removal of Trim Drag & Large Empennage: A vehicle balanced dynamically around neutral or unstable equilibrium eliminates the drag and structural mass of large, passive stabilizing surfaces.
Boundary-Layer & Ground-Effect Coupling: Operating close to varied surfaces (water, pack ice, broken terrain) creates volatile ground-effect shifts that passive aircraft cannot handle. Dynamic equilibrium treats these pressure variations not as hazardous disturbances, but as immediate inputs to be modulated.
The Multi-Modal Envelope: Once a craft does not depend on fragile, high-aspect-ratio wings for passive pitch stability, a streamlined hull can operate seamlessly across fluid boundaries—transitioning from water displacement to surface skimming to atmospheric flight.
Modern avionics and high-frequency inertial sensors are now capable of executing micro-adjustments far beyond human reaction times.
Technical Question for Discussion:
Given modern sensor bandwidth and active control authority, what fundamental aerodynamic or control-theory bottlenecks still justify our persistent engineering reliance on passive static stability in high-efficiency transport design?

Personal Projects Help designing Fixed Wing UAV: A-Tail Section
galleryI am a junior in high school and been working on this fixed wing (hopefully) UAV project. Anybody have any sort of idea on A-Tail configurations?Been going back and forth on my A-Tail sizing for way too long and could use a gut check from anyone who's actually done this before. It's a hand-launched twin boom pusher, no landing gear so it's a belly lander, wing's about 0.508 m² with a 189mm MAC and 2.8m span, tapered from 245mm at the root down to 118mm at the tip, running the Wortmann FX 63-137 which has a pretty gnarly pitching moment (Cm around -0.185). Booms give me roughly a 1000mm tail arm. I used the tail volume coefficient method to size things, went with Vh of 0.5 and Vv of 0.03 (leaned toward the higher end because of that pitching moment), and after converting that into a single V-tail angle I landed on something like 43° for the dihedral, with each panel coming out to around 426mm span and 107mm chord. Planning NACA 0010 for the tail airfoil since it's symmetric, and sizing the ruddervators around 45-50% of local chord. Main things I'm unsure about: is 43° reasonable for an inverted V or is that going to bite me on ground clearance during landing since there's no gear, are my Vh/Vv numbers actually sane for something like this, and has anyone actually built an inverted V with a flat section in the middle for the boom mount and servos — curious if there's anything I'm not seeing coming. Would really appreciate any input, feels like I've just been spinning on this part.

galleryProject Pixel Orbital is a completely student-led team at Stanford OHS with the goal of launching an 3U CubeSat capable of conducting experiments in low Earth orbit - from photographing Earth to performing analysis on photos of earth and space with onboard instruments. Our mission is to get to orbit, perform a detumble, establish contact with our ground station(s), and capture an image of Earth for downlink. We hope that PixelSat I will inspire other people and prove that if a group of high schoolers can build a satellite from scratch with very little funding and no adult supervision, anyone can. It will open the door for schools and small businesses to launch satellites similar to ours, and will overall make space more accessible.
